Frequently asked questions about lodges in Burnie

  • What is the best time of the year to visit Burnie?

    Burnie has a mild, temperate climate. The best time to visit is during the spring (September to November) or autumn (March to May) when the weather is pleasant and the crowds are smaller.

  • Is the air clean and the environment pollution-free in the Burnie region?

    Burnie is known for its clean air and beautiful natural surroundings. The region has a strong focus on environmental protection, so you can enjoy the fresh air and stunning scenery without worrying about pollution.

  • What adventurous activities can you enjoy in and around Burnie?

    Burnie is a great base for adventurous activities. You can go hiking in Cradle Mountain-Lake St Clair National Park, kayaking on the Bass Strait, or even try your hand at rock climbing at the nearby Walls of Jerusalem National Park.

  • What other towns or cities are interesting to check out near Burnie?

    Devonport is a charming coastal town with a bustling waterfront and historic buildings. You can also visit the nearby town of Sheffield, known for its colourful murals painted on buildings. And if you're looking for a bigger city, Launceston is about an hour and a half drive away.
